Mariana (Architecture BFA at SCAD - regular user)- Has to wait too long- Does not see the café when she comes in ExLibris (needs to know about it / discover it)- There is no bathroom- The machine to swipe card is not working properly- Parking is often packed

Jittery Joe’s staff who takes/makes/gives order- Either bored when there is no one or overwhelmed when there are too many customers for only one staff member- Parking is often packed- Bathroom is on second floor if they need to go they need to leave counter unattended - uncomfortable situation

IMPROVEMENTS NEEDED:PAYING MACHINE

- Get a new one - New system (ie. like iPad in Butterhead Green Café) - Enter the card number instead of swiping it- Have a machine that takes a picture of card instead of swipe- Magnetic payment- Encouraging cash payment (discount)

IMPROVEMENTS NEEDED:WAITING IN LINE- Staff takes order before, when customer comes in the line (ie. McDonalds)- Increase the number of staff members- Hand-in menus to people waiting so that they know what they want when they arrive at cashier’s- Possibility to order from an app/website in advance (ie. I need a coffee for my 8am tomorrow)- Have more cashiers
